Output 15966ba99cf3e11590db63b2b0a9eb9816730f2a1e0bb7471f87335ccb412d26:29

value
46588837
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c744560109df40fa734319a7b5107d4f3102ade OP_EQUAL
address
3MnfsPybiWfLZZpivhRkVKuQ7KuzwyT732
transaction
15966ba99cf3e11590db63b2b0a9eb9816730f2a1e0bb7471f87335ccb412d26
spent
true